Solution for 9y(4y-y)=24. equation:



9y(4y-y)=24.
We move all terms to the left:
9y(4y-y)-(24.)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
9y(+3y)-24=0
We multiply parentheses
27y^2-24=0
a = 27; b = 0; c = -24;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= 02-4·27·(-24)
Δ = 2592
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$y_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$y_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

The end solution:
$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{2592}=\sqrt{1296*2}=\sqrt{1296}*\sqrt{2}=36\sqrt{2}$
$y_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)-36\sqrt{2}}{2*27}=\frac{0-36\sqrt{2}}{54} =-\frac{36\sqrt{2}}{54} =-\frac{2\sqrt{2}}{3} $
$y_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)+36\sqrt{2}}{2*27}=\frac{0+36\sqrt{2}}{54} =\frac{36\sqrt{2}}{54} =\frac{2\sqrt{2}}{3} $
